Is Red Robin Still in Business? The Juicy Truth

Yes, Red Robin is still very much in business. Despite navigating the turbulent waters of the restaurant industry, they continue to operate hundreds of locations across North America and remain a recognizable name synonymous with gourmet burgers and family-friendly dining.

1. How many Red Robin locations are there currently?

The number of Red Robin locations fluctuates due to openings and closures. However, as of 2024, there are around 500 Red Robin restaurants located primarily in the United States and Canada. Always check their official website for the most up-to-date count.

2. Has Red Robin filed for bankruptcy?

No, Red Robin has not filed for bankruptcy. While they’ve faced financial challenges and have closed some underperforming restaurants, they haven’t taken that step. They continue to operate and adapt to the market conditions.

3. What is Red Robin known for?

Red Robin is primarily known for its gourmet burgers, a wide variety of toppings, and its bottomless fries. They offer a casual dining experience with a focus on family-friendly atmosphere and customizable meal options. They also have a good reputation for their milkshakes and other specialty drinks.

4. Did Red Robin close any restaurants recently?

Yes, Red Robin has closed some restaurants in recent years. These closures are part of their strategy to optimize their portfolio and improve overall profitability. The decision to close a location is based on several factors, including performance, lease terms, and market conditions.

5. What are Red Robin’s most popular menu items?

Some of Red Robin’s most popular menu items include the Gourmet Cheeseburger, the Whiskey River BBQ Burger, and, of course, their bottomless steak fries. Their onion rings and a variety of milkshakes are also customer favorites. They often introduce limited-time offer (LTO) burgers that generate significant buzz.

7. What is Red Robin Royalty?

Red Robin Royalty is their loyalty program. Members earn points for every purchase, which can be redeemed for rewards, such as free menu items, discounts, and special offers. It’s a great way to save money and get exclusive deals.

9. What is the history of Red Robin?

Red Robin started as a tavern in Seattle, Washington, in 1940. It was originally called “Sam’s Tavern,” but the owner, Sam, changed the name to Red Robin after becoming fond of a barbershop quartet singing that name. The restaurant began focusing on burgers in the 1960s and eventually expanded into a national chain.

11. How has the COVID-19 pandemic affected Red Robin?

The COVID-19 pandemic significantly impacted Red Robin, leading to temporary restaurant closures, reduced seating capacity, and increased reliance on online ordering and delivery. They adapted by implementing safety measures, streamlining operations, and focusing on digital engagement.
